The Nuts and Bolts: Core Components

Think of a base station's energy storage system as a three-layer cake:

1. The Energy Sponge (Storage Devices)

  • Lithium-ion batteries: The rockstars of energy storage (60% market share in telecom)
  • Flow batteries: New kids on the block with 10+ hour discharge capabilities
  • Supercapacitors: The sprinters that handle sudden power surges

2. The Shape-Shifter (Power Conversion System)

This electrical translator converts DC battery power to AC for equipment – like a multilingual diplomat for electrons. Modern systems achieve 97% conversion efficiency, wasting less energy than your grandma's 20-year-old fridge[4].

3. The Brain (Control System)

An AI-powered maestro that:

  • Predicts weather patterns for solar/wind energy harvesting
  • Monitors battery health like a digital doctor
  • Prioritizes power distribution during outages

When the Lights Go Out: Emergency Operation

Here's where the magic happens:

  1. Grid power fails (storm, maintenance, or that raccoon chewing wires)
  2. Storage system activates in 20 milliseconds – faster than you blink
  3. Batteries power critical systems while supercapacitors handle 5G's power spikes
  4. Backup generators kick in if outage exceeds battery capacity

China Mobile's hybrid systems kept 98.7% of stations operational during 2023 typhoon season[4]. Now that's reliability!

The 5G Factor: Hungrier Networks Demand Smarter Storage

5G's appetite is staggering:

  • 3x more energy-hungry than 4G
  • Requires 3-5x more base stations for coverage

Enter liquid-cooled battery cabinets and phase-change materials that absorb heat like a digital ice pack. Huawei's latest 5G stations use "battery hibernation" tech, extending lifespan by 30% through strategic charging patterns[7].

Real-World Warriors: Case Studies

Case 1: Orange's African Network
Deployed zinc-air batteries in Sahara regions where temperatures hit 50°C. Result? 40% fewer battery replacements and 24/7 connectivity for remote villages.

Case 2: AT&T's Hurricane Prep
Pre-positioned mobile storage units on trailers before storm season. These "energy ambulances" kept critical towers online during 2024's record hurricane season.

Maintenance Pro Tip

Don't be that engineer who forgets battery checkups! Set calendar reminders for:

  • Monthly state-of-charge verification
  • Quarterly thermal imaging scans
  • Annual capacity testing
